Life Insurance Corporation of India (LICI) emerged as one of the most actively traded stocks on 7 August 2026, registering a remarkable surge in volume that outpaced sector and benchmark indices. Despite a modest price gain, the stock’s technical indicators and investor participation reveal a complex picture that warrants close attention from market participants.
Life Insurance Corporation of India Sees Exceptional Volume Amid Bearish Technicals

Robust Trading Volumes Highlight Investor Interest

On 7 August 2026, LICI recorded a total traded volume of 1.55 crore shares, translating to a traded value of approximately ₹609.5 crore. This volume represents a significant spike compared to its recent averages, with delivery volume on 6 August soaring to 4.16 crore shares—an increase of 256.18% over the five-day average delivery volume. Such heightened activity signals strong investor engagement, possibly driven by fresh institutional interest or speculative trading ahead of upcoming corporate developments.

The stock opened at ₹393.45, touched a high of ₹396.85, and closed near ₹392.00 by 09:44 IST, marking a day change of +1.08%. This outperformance is notable against the insurance sector’s 1-day return of -1.30% and the Sensex’s marginal decline of -0.13%, underscoring LICI’s relative strength in a broadly subdued market environment.

Price Action and Technical Landscape

Despite the volume surge, LICI’s price movement has been confined within a narrow range of just ₹0.50, indicating a consolidation phase rather than a breakout. The stock currently trades below its key moving averages—5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day—suggesting that the short- to long-term technical momentum remains weak. This positioning often reflects cautious investor sentiment, with the market awaiting clearer directional cues.

LICI’s Mojo Score stands at 45.0, categorised as a ‘Sell’ grade, a downgrade from its previous ‘Hold’ rating on 7 July 2026. This downgrade reflects deteriorating technical and fundamental parameters as assessed by MarketsMOJO’s proprietary analytics. The large-cap insurance giant’s market capitalisation remains robust at ₹4,96,006.32 crore, affirming its status as a heavyweight in the sector despite recent rating challenges.

Accumulation and Distribution Signals

The surge in delivery volumes coupled with a narrow price range suggests a phase of accumulation by certain investor cohorts, possibly institutional players building positions quietly. However, the lack of a decisive price breakout tempers enthusiasm, as distribution by profit-taking traders cannot be ruled out. The interplay of these forces often precedes significant directional moves, making LICI a stock to watch closely in the coming sessions.

Liquidity metrics further support active trading, with the stock’s liquidity sufficient to accommodate trade sizes up to ₹26.12 crore based on 2% of the five-day average traded value. This level of liquidity is favourable for both retail and institutional investors seeking to enter or exit sizeable positions without excessive price impact.

Sector Context and Comparative Performance

Within the insurance sector, LICI’s outperformance on the day is significant given the sector’s overall negative return of -1.30%. This divergence may reflect company-specific factors such as investor anticipation of policy reforms, earnings updates, or strategic initiatives. However, the broader sector headwinds, including regulatory uncertainties and competitive pressures, continue to weigh on sentiment.

LICI’s large-cap status provides it with a degree of stability and investor confidence, yet the downgrade in Mojo Grade to ‘Sell’ signals caution. Investors should weigh the stock’s strong liquidity and volume dynamics against its subdued technical momentum and sector challenges.

Outlook and Investor Considerations

For investors, the current scenario presents a mixed picture. The exceptional volume surge and rising delivery volumes indicate growing interest and potential accumulation, which could presage a positive price movement if confirmed by a breakout above key resistance levels. Conversely, the stock’s position below all major moving averages and the recent downgrade in rating suggest that downside risks remain.

Market participants should monitor LICI’s price action closely over the next few trading sessions, paying particular attention to volume patterns and any shifts in technical indicators. A sustained move above the 5-day and 20-day moving averages accompanied by continued high volumes would be a bullish signal. Conversely, failure to break out could lead to further consolidation or a decline.
